Output 50957deda4b4ad9822d6c671fcd701fb90a0654253cbda1ab4dc4f6d2fea1845:0

value
594660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c338043965bd268e42e4ef8dbe0d9771c3bf8c99 OP_EQUAL
address
3KVEo3axpXtJnoofMyg4ofs7YCsNPXfQ2t
transaction
50957deda4b4ad9822d6c671fcd701fb90a0654253cbda1ab4dc4f6d2fea1845
spent
true